Question Transmission Shift Problem

My 98 chevy pickup (V6 Auto Trans) has quit downshifting when I try to accelerate while passing. It shifts fine during normal acceleration and deceleration but just doesn't drop down a gear when I really need to step on it. Any suggestions as to what the problem might be and how to diagnose it????

Re: Transmission Shift Problem

Need to watch the data stream on a scanner. Any codes? Sometimes with a trans service the pan can hit the 3-2 downshift solenoid (or shift solenoids for that matter) or 3-2 solenoid could just be no good any longer. Thats just a guess as no data stream in front of me.
